On Mon, 17 Nov 2003, M A Young wrote:

> On Mon, 17 Nov 2003, Dan Goodes wrote:
> 
> > I've been running fedora (FC1) since it was released, and test 3 before
> > that, and am happy with it.
> >
> > I want to try arjan's test kernels from
> >
> > http://people.redhat.com/~arjanv/2.5/
> >
> > I read through some threads on the mailing list, and it seemed the best
> > solution would be to just use up2date (since the config is already there).
> >
> > So I uncommented that line from the /etc/sysconfig/rhn/sources file, and
> > ran "up2date kernel-unsupported" (not 100% true - it took a LOT of reading
> > to find that I had to run "up2date --nosig kernel-unsupported").
> 
> kernel-unsupported is a collection of unsupported modules, not the kernel
> itself. You probably want up2date kernel.
